**Q: How does the guest Wi-Fi desk at reception work overnight?**

A: The guest Wi-Fi desk at Branlow Gate reception stays staffed until 21:00 only. After that, night shift handles guest network requests. Vouchers are printed from the terminal behind the desk; one voucher per visitor, valid 12 hours. Do not hand out staff network details. Log each voucher issued in the overnight book. The terminal locks after ten minutes idle. To unlock the reception terminal cabinet, enter the code below.

turnstile pass: bdg-FYC-7

Two custodians must be present; verify both against the custodian roster before proceeding. Generate the keypair on the air-gapped laptop, confirm the fingerprint aloud, and record it in the ceremony log. Seal the hardware token in the tamper-evident bag. Before sealing, the token must be initialized with the recovery passphrase written directly below.

recovery phrase for tawef-bawef: ralath-jorius-casok-julok

## Building Access — Level 6 Opening, Carnmore Exchange

Level 6 of Carnmore Exchange opens to contractors on Monday. All visiting contractors must sign in at the ground-floor security desk, present photo ID, and wear a visitor lanyard at all times. Access to Level 6 is via the east lift bank only; the west lifts do not yet stop there. Hot works require a separate permit from the site manager. The stairwell door at Level 6 is code-controlled during the fit-out period. Enter using the code below.

badge for badup-kahif: bdg-LHI-9